Looking Again - Advice Needed

All,

Sold the 87 911 targa a year ago and have been regretting it ever since. Looking to get into another P car soon. Came across this local car and have a couple of questions.

Are the RUF upgrades worth more money? If so, 10%? 20%? Above market? I know that I need to check the paperwork, etc. Let's assume it looks solid.
Are the wheels that special?
This car has some nice features. I was thinking it was probably worth $40k...what do you think?
Am I missing anything?

Appreciate the input.


1986 PORSCHE 911 CARRERA COUPE - RUF upgrades
MOSTLY ORIGINAL PAINT. NO ACCIDENTS.
BOOK AND RECORDS
FACTORY FRONT AND REAR SPOILERS
SPORT SEATS
LIMITED SLIP
SHORT SHIFTER
FACTORY 8 AND 9 INCH STAGGERED 16" WHEELS
RUF GMBH 3.4 LITER ENGINE
NEW CAM SHAFTS, PISTONS, AND CYLINDERS
RUF DUAL EXHAUST
RUF EXHAUST
56k MILES

The Ruf 3.4 liter engine, if documented is probably +$3-4K on value. The wheels appear to be chromed, which is pretty much -$3K value if so.

The other as-delivered items like sport seats and limited slip add a few grand. Spoilers? A matter of personal preference, but -$1K or so if you want to go without the wing.

The color would be a +15%, IMO.

I think the OP's view on market value is spot on.
